Sure, YouTube is filled with great stuff for kids to view. It’s also packed with videos that, well, aren’t too great
for them to view. How to keep a young surfer on a safe path? Try TotLOL, a monitored front-end to YouTube that offers only G-rated videos for the young ‘uns. It’s free!
